Kita sering mendengar istilah HTTPS ketika berselancar di internet. Namun, sebenarnya apa sih HTTPS itu? Mengapa banyak situs web yang sudah beralih ke HTTPS dari HTTP? Di artikel ini, kita akan membahas pengertian HTTPS dan fungsinya secara mendalam.
Apa Itu HTTPS?
HTTPS adalah singkatan dari Hypertext Transfer Protocol Secure. Pada dasarnya, HTTPS adalah versi aman dari HTTP, protokol yang digunakan untuk mengirimkan data antara browser pengguna dan situs web yang mereka kunjungi. Perbedaannya terletak pada tambahan lapisan enkripsi yang membuat data lebih aman saat dikirimkan.
Protokol HTTPS menggunakan Secure Sockets Layer (SSL) atau Transport Layer Security (TLS) untuk mengenkripsi komunikasi antara pengguna dan server. Ini berarti, ketika kita mengunjungi situs web dengan HTTPS, data yang kita kirimkan – seperti informasi login, nomor kartu kredit, atau data pribadi lainnya – akan terlindungi dan tidak mudah diakses oleh pihak yang tidak berwenang.
Sejarah Singkat HTTPS
Protokol HTTPS pertama kali diperkenalkan oleh Netscape pada tahun 1994. Tujuan utamanya saat itu adalah untuk melindungi informasi sensitif seperti data perbankan dan pembayaran online. Seiring berkembangnya teknologi dan semakin banyaknya ancaman di dunia maya, penggunaan HTTPS pun semakin meluas ke berbagai jenis situs web, mulai dari situs e-commerce, media sosial, hingga blog pribadi.
Mengapa HTTPS Penting?
Penggunaan HTTPS menjadi sangat penting karena beberapa alasan utama:
Keamanan Data: Dengan adanya enkripsi, data yang ditransfer antara pengguna dan server menjadi lebih sulit diintersepsi oleh pihak ketiga. Ini sangat penting terutama untuk melindungi informasi sensitif.
Kepercayaan Pengguna: Situs web yang menggunakan HTTPS biasanya dianggap lebih terpercaya oleh pengguna. Bahkan, beberapa browser modern seperti Google Chrome akan memberikan peringatan jika kita mengunjungi situs yang tidak menggunakan HTTPS.
SEO (Search Engine Optimization): Google mengonfirmasi bahwa mereka memberikan preferensi pada situs yang menggunakan HTTPS dalam hasil pencarian mereka. Ini berarti, jika kita ingin situs web kita memiliki peringkat yang baik di Google, penggunaan HTTPS sangat dianjurkan.
Validasi Identitas Situs: Sertifikat SSL yang digunakan dalam HTTPS tidak hanya mengenkripsi data, tetapi juga memverifikasi identitas situs web. Hal ini membantu mencegah serangan phishing yang sering terjadi di internet.
Bagaimana HTTPS Bekerja?
Proses kerja HTTPS sebenarnya cukup kompleks, tapi kita akan coba sederhanakan. Ketika kita mengakses situs web dengan HTTPS, berikut adalah beberapa langkah yang terjadi di belakang layar:
Handshake SSL/TLS: Ketika browser kita mengakses situs HTTPS, pertama-tama akan terjadi proses SSL/TLS handshake. Di sini, browser dan server saling bertukar kunci enkripsi untuk memastikan komunikasi yang aman.
Enkripsi Data: Setelah kunci enkripsi disepakati, semua data yang dikirimkan antara browser dan server akan dienkripsi. Ini berarti, meskipun ada pihak ketiga yang mencoba menyadap komunikasi, mereka hanya akan melihat data yang tidak dapat dibaca tanpa kunci enkripsi.
Validasi Sertifikat: Selama proses handshake, browser juga akan memeriksa sertifikat SSL yang diberikan oleh server. Sertifikat ini dikeluarkan oleh otoritas sertifikasi (CA) yang tepercaya, sehingga pengguna bisa yakin bahwa mereka berkomunikasi dengan server yang sah.
Transfer Data Aman: Setelah semua tahap di atas selesai, transfer data antara browser dan server berlangsung dengan aman hingga sesi tersebut selesai.
Perbedaan Antara HTTP dan HTTPS
Meskipun terlihat serupa, HTTP dan HTTPS memiliki beberapa perbedaan mendasar yang membuat HTTPS lebih unggul dalam hal keamanan dan kepercayaan pengguna:
Enkripsi: HTTP tidak memiliki mekanisme enkripsi, sehingga data yang ditransfer bisa dengan mudah diakses oleh pihak ketiga. Sementara itu, HTTPS menggunakan SSL/TLS untuk mengenkripsi data, sehingga lebih aman.
Validasi Identitas: HTTP tidak memverifikasi identitas situs web, sehingga rawan terhadap serangan phishing. Di sisi lain, HTTPS memverifikasi identitas situs melalui sertifikat SSL, memberikan jaminan bahwa kita berkomunikasi dengan pihak yang benar.
SEO: Google dan mesin pencari lainnya memberikan preferensi pada situs yang menggunakan HTTPS. Ini berarti, jika situs kita masih menggunakan HTTP, kemungkinan besar peringkat kita akan kalah dari kompetitor yang sudah menggunakan HTTPS.
Kepercayaan Pengguna: Pengguna internet kini lebih cerdas dalam memilih situs web yang aman. Situs dengan HTTPS cenderung lebih dipercaya dan dikunjungi oleh pengguna dibandingkan dengan situs yang masih menggunakan HTTP.
Cara Beralih ke HTTPS
Berpindah dari HTTP ke HTTPS mungkin terdengar rumit, tetapi sebenarnya prosesnya bisa cukup sederhana jika kita mengikuti langkah-langkah yang tepat. Berikut adalah panduan singkat untuk beralih ke HTTPS:
Dapatkan Sertifikat SSL/TLS: Langkah pertama adalah mendapatkan sertifikat SSL dari otoritas sertifikasi (CA) tepercaya. Ada berbagai jenis sertifikat SSL yang tersedia, mulai dari yang gratis hingga berbayar dengan tingkat keamanan yang lebih tinggi.
Install Sertifikat SSL: Setelah mendapatkan sertifikat, kita perlu menginstalnya di server hosting situs web kita. Proses instalasi biasanya bervariasi tergantung pada penyedia hosting yang kita gunakan.
Konfigurasi Server: Setelah sertifikat terpasang, kita perlu mengonfigurasi server untuk menggunakan HTTPS. Ini biasanya melibatkan pengaturan ulang file .htaccess atau server configurations lainnya.
Redirect HTTP ke HTTPS: Agar semua pengunjung diarahkan ke versi HTTPS dari situs web kita, kita perlu menambahkan redirect 301 dari HTTP ke HTTPS. Ini memastikan bahwa semua trafik otomatis diarahkan ke versi aman dari situs kita.
Perbarui Internal Links: Setelah beralih ke HTTPS, pastikan semua tautan internal di situs web kita sudah mengarah ke versi HTTPS. Ini termasuk tautan di menu, sidebar, footer, dan konten halaman.
Perbarui Eksternal Links dan Backlinks: Jika memungkinkan, hubungi situs web yang memberikan backlink ke situs kita dan minta mereka untuk memperbarui tautan ke versi HTTPS.
Verifikasi di Google Search Console: Terakhir, pastikan untuk memverifikasi versi HTTPS situs kita di Google Search Console. Ini membantu Google memahami bahwa kita telah beralih ke HTTPS dan mempengaruhi peringkat di mesin pencari.
Jenis-Jenis Sertifikat SSL
Saat beralih ke HTTPS, penting untuk mengetahui jenis-jenis sertifikat SSL yang tersedia. Berikut adalah beberapa jenis yang paling umum:
Domain Validated (DV) SSL: Jenis sertifikat SSL ini paling dasar dan hanya memverifikasi kepemilikan domain. DV SSL cocok untuk situs web pribadi atau blog yang tidak mengumpulkan informasi sensitif.
Organization Validated (OV) SSL: Sertifikat ini memverifikasi kepemilikan domain dan identitas organisasi. Cocok untuk bisnis atau organisasi yang membutuhkan lebih banyak kepercayaan dari pengguna.
Extended Validation (EV) SSL: Ini adalah jenis sertifikat SSL tertinggi yang memerlukan verifikasi menyeluruh terhadap identitas perusahaan. Situs web dengan EV SSL sering menampilkan nama perusahaan di sebelah bilah alamat sebagai tanda kepercayaan ekstra.
Wildcard SSL: Sertifikat ini melindungi domain utama dan semua subdomainnya. Misalnya, jika kita memiliki situs web dengan subdomain seperti blog.domain.com atau shop.domain.com, kita hanya perlu satu sertifikat wildcard untuk melindungi semuanya.
Multi-Domain SSL: Jenis sertifikat ini memungkinkan kita untuk melindungi beberapa domain sekaligus dengan satu sertifikat. Cocok untuk organisasi besar dengan banyak situs web.
Pengaruh HTTPS terhadap SEO
Menggunakan HTTPS bukan hanya tentang keamanan, tetapi juga berdampak besar pada SEO. Google telah menyatakan bahwa HTTPS adalah salah satu sinyal peringkat dalam algoritma pencariannya. Berikut adalah beberapa cara bagaimana HTTPS dapat memengaruhi peringkat kita:
Peningkatan Peringkat: Situs web yang menggunakan HTTPS cenderung memiliki peringkat lebih tinggi di hasil pencarian Google dibandingkan dengan situs yang masih menggunakan HTTP.
Kecepatan Situs: Meskipun HTTPS bisa memperlambat situs jika tidak dioptimalkan dengan benar, penggunaan teknologi modern seperti HTTP/2 dapat membuat situs lebih cepat, yang juga menjadi faktor penting dalam SEO.
Pengalaman Pengguna: Situs dengan HTTPS memberikan pengalaman yang lebih aman dan terpercaya bagi pengguna. Hal ini meningkatkan dwell time dan reduces bounce rate, dua faktor yang memengaruhi peringkat kita di Google.
Keamanan SERP: Google juga mulai memberikan peringatan pada hasil pencarian yang mengarah ke situs HTTP, yang bisa mengurangi jumlah klik ke situs kita.
Mitos Tentang HTTPS
Ada beberapa mitos tentang HTTPS yang masih beredar, dan penting bagi kita untuk memahaminya dengan benar:
HTTPS Hanya Diperlukan untuk Situs E-Commerce: Ini tidak benar. Meskipun HTTPS awalnya lebih umum digunakan untuk situs e-commerce, saat ini setiap situs web yang ingin melindungi data penggunanya sebaiknya menggunakan HTTPS.
HTTPS Memperlambat Situs: Ini juga salah. Dengan teknologi modern seperti HTTP/2, situs dengan HTTPS bisa sama cepat atau bahkan lebih cepat daripada situs HTTP.
HTTPS Mahal: Banyak orang berpikir bahwa mendapatkan sertifikat SSL itu mahal. Padahal, ada banyak opsi gratis seperti Let's Encrypt yang bisa digunakan untuk mengamankan situs kita.
HTTPS Sulit Dipasang: Dengan panduan yang tepat dan dukungan dari penyedia hosting, pemasangan HTTPS bisa dilakukan dengan mudah bahkan oleh pemula.
Kesimpulan
HTTPS bukan lagi sekadar pilihan, melainkan kebutuhan bagi setiap situs web yang ingin tetap relevan dan aman di era digital ini. Dari melindungi data pengguna hingga meningkatkan peringkat di mesin pencari, ada banyak manfaat yang bisa kita dapatkan dengan beralih ke HTTPS. Jadi, jika situs kita masih menggunakan HTTP, sekarang adalah waktu yang tepat untuk melakukan migrasi ke HTTPS dan menikmati semua keunggulannya.